Transaction e44be0e1b53768093cc31875a594df1939617536465164293ab4a203402ec51a
1 Input
1 Output
-
e44be0e1b53768093cc31875a594df1939617536465164293ab4a203402ec51a:0
- value
- 613640
- script pubkey
- OP_0 OP_PUSHBYTES_32 eb17c2e6482a4a9df3430fd4f14ef6ade80cf34b5ce82a5b7a9b7fe22d2469a5
- address
- bc1qavtu9ejg9f9fmu6rpl20znhk4h5qeu6ttn5z5km6ndl7ytfydxjsxw6x8k